One of the most popular Christmas markets in Europe is the Christkindlesmarkt in Nuremberg, Germany. This iconic market has been a holiday tradition for over 400 years and attracts visitors from all over the world. The market is easily accessible by train, with Nuremberg’s Hauptbahnhof (central station) located just a short walk away from the market square. As you step off the train, you’ll be greeted by the sights and sounds of the festive market stalls selling handmade ornaments, delicious treats, and traditional wooden toys.
Another must-visit Christmas market is the Winter Wonderland in London, UK. This enchanting market is set up in Hyde Park and features a plethora of festive activities, including ice skating, a giant observation wheel, and an impressive Christmas light display. Traveling to Winter Wonderland by rail is a convenient option, as the market is located near several tube stations and overground rail services. You can easily take a train to London and then hop on public transportation to reach the market in no time.
If you’re looking for a more exotic Christmas market experience, consider taking the Glacier Express to the Christmas market in Zermatt, Switzerland. This scenic train journey takes you through the snow-capped Swiss Alps, offering breathtaking views of the winter wonderland outside your window. Once you arrive in Zermatt, you can wander through the charming village and explore the festive market filled with Swiss handicrafts, local delicacies, and twinkling Christmas lights.
